Diebold Nixdorf Appoints Andy Zosel as CPTO to Accelerate AI-Driven Product Innovation
Diebold Nixdorf appointed Andy Zosel as executive vice president and chief product and technology officer to lead its unified product and technology organization across banking and retail. He will define global execution standards and leverage AI to accelerate product development, streamline solution deployment, and drive scalable growth.
1. New Chief Product and Technology Officer
Diebold Nixdorf appointed Andy Zosel as executive vice president and chief product and technology officer. In his newly created role, Zosel will lead the unified Product and Technology organization across banking and retail to align product management, engineering, R&D, and innovation.
2. Strategic Focus and Mandate
Zosel will establish global execution standards, accelerate time to market, and streamline solution deployment. The organization will leverage artificial intelligence and emerging technologies to build a scalable, future-ready portfolio and meet evolving customer needs.
3. Leadership Experience
Zosel brings nearly 30 years of technology and product development leadership, including roles as senior vice president and general manager of Intelligent Automation at Zebra Technologies, divisional president at Omron, and vice president of engineering and marketing at Microscan.
